The courses of the Master of Architecture Preparation Program are interrelated. The goal of our curriculum is to help students to improve their design skills and to help our students complete a high-quality design portfolio for successful application to Master of Architecture programs. The program focuses on the following three courses:
1. Design Studio
The content of this program is quite
similar to that found in the first year of
leading Master of Architecture programs.
The style of teaching involves lectures,
one-on-one progress reviews, and weekly
collective review and mid-term/ final
guest reviews. The intent of the studio is
to help students through design thinking,
structure, modeling, urban context, and
other design issues to complete one to two
professional quality projects. For students
who need to start applying right away, the
studio project can focus on the improvement
of previous projects. At the the end of
this course, students will have a tremendous
improvement in design skills to help in
the completion of one or two high-quality
designs for the Master of Architecture
application.
2. 3D Model Building Modeling Course
The modeling course focuses on improving
students’ 3D modeling skills. Our faculty
teaches software including Rhino surface
modeling, Grasshopper parametric design,
and T-Splines. During the course, students
will learn how to use ths software to
construct complex 3D models and render
them s part of the final work of the
design class. In addition, architectural
modeling lessons will guide students
through the creation of independent
pieces of work to demonstrate their
modeling skills in their portfolio.
Students will also have access to
advanced physical model making
techniques such as 3D printing.
3. 2D Graphic Course
In this graphics and presentation course,
students will learn the advanced
methods of architectural presentation
including 3d renderings, professional
plan/section drawings,and the graphic
design of their portfolios. We teach
software including Vray, Adobe Photoshop,
Adobe Illustrator, and Adobe Indesign.
The 2D graphics course is also closely
related to the above two courses.
Students will visualize the result of
the design class through this graphic
focused course.
In addition, the 2D graphics presentation
course will also help students to
improve and perfect the graphic
expression of students’ previous works
to better reflect the design language of
American architecture schools.
William M. Taylor, FAIA
Design Studio and Founding Director
William receive his M-Arch degree from
Cranbrook Academy of Art where he studied
with Daniel Libeskind for 3 years. Before
founding LAIAD in 2001, William has
taught architectural design since 1983,
with positions at Harvard University,
the University of Houston, and at
California State Polytechnic University,
Pomona, where he developed an innovative
new program for basic architectural
design. William is also a principal at
TFO Architecture in Los Angeles and is
involved with a variety of local and
international projects.
William has persistently explored the
relationship between form and idea
and his work at LAIAD is an outgrowth
of a 30-year effort, in both teaching
and practice, to develop and promote a
design methodology based on idea and
order rather than visual composition.
In recognition of his work at LAIAD,
William was recognized with the AIA Los
Angeles Educator of the Year award in
2005. His design work has been featured in
magazines such as L’Arca, Arkkitehti, and
A+U and been included in international
exhibitions including the Venice Biennale,
the Milan Triennale, the Centre Pompidou,
and the Museum of Finnish Architecture,
where it is part of the permanent
collection.

LAIAD Summer Program:
One Month Summer Courses
(July 15 - August 9)
The one-month courses will include a total of
64 hours of design studio, 32 hours 3D modeling
training class, 32 hours two-dimensional
architectural expression class and 18 hours of
architecture field trip. Design courses will
be taught from Monday to Thursday, and we will
arrange architecture field trip or independent
study time on Friday.
The weekly course schedule is as follows:
Monday to Thursday
+ 4 hours design studio
+ 2 hours 3D modeling class
+ 2 hours architectural drawing class
Friday
Architecture field trip
After the first day of school, each
student will be assigned to a studio
space in the school. Students can use
the studio space during the summer
program even after normal hours.
